<h1><a name="data_mining_of_vzt_files_vztminer" id="data_mining_of_vzt_files_vztminer">Data mining of VZT files (vztminer)</a></h1>
<div class="level1">
<pre class="code">VZTMINER(1)		     Dumpfile Data Mining		   VZTMINER(1)



NAME
       vztminer - Data mining of VZT files

SYNTAX
       vztminer [option]... [VZTFILE]

DESCRIPTION
       Mines  VZT  files  for  specific data values and generates gtkwave save
       files to stdout for future reload.

OPTIONS
       -d,--dumpfile &lt;filename&gt;
	      Specify VZT input dumpfile.

       -m,--match &lt;filename&gt;
	      Specifies &quot;bitwise&quot; match data (binary, real, string)

       -x,--hex &lt;value&gt;
	      Specifies hexadecimal match data that will automatically be con-
	      verted to binary for searches

       -n,--namesonly
	      Indicates	 that  only  facnames  should  be printed in a gtkwave
	      savefile compatible format.  By doing this, the file can be used
	      to specify which traces are to be imported into gtkwave.

       -h,--help
	      Show help screen.

EXAMPLES
       vztminer dumpfile.vzt --match 20470000 -n

       This attempts to match the hex value 20470000 across all facilities and
       when the value is encountered, the facname only is printed to stdout in
       order to generate a gtkwave compatible save file.

LIMITATIONS
       vztminer	 only  prints the first time a value is encountered for a spe-
       cific net.  This is done in order to cut down on	 the  size  of	output
       files  and to aid in following data such as addresses through a simula-
       tion model.
